Understanding Security Protocols at Spin-Dinero Casino
Security is the cornerstone of any reputable online casino, and spin-dinero-casino.co.nz aims to provide a secure environment for its players. Robust encryption technology, specifically Secure Socket Layer (SSL) or Transport Layer Security (TLS), is typically employed to protect data transmitted between the player’s device and the casino’s servers. This encryption scrambles information, making it unreadable to unauthorized parties. The effectiveness of this technology lies in its ability to prevent eavesdropping and data interception during online transactions. Regular audits by independent security firms are also vital, verifying that the casino's security systems are up to date and functioning correctly. These audits often assess vulnerability to various cyberattacks and penetrate testing.
Beyond encryption, responsible data handling practices are essential. A secure casino will have clearly defined privacy policies outlining how player information is collected, used, and stored. Compliance with relevant data protection reg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) for players within the European Economic Area, demonstrates a commitment to user privacy. Furthermore, the casino should employ firewalls and intrusion detection systems to prevent unauthorized access to its servers. A multi-layered security approach, incorporating both technical safeguards and robust policies, is the hallmark of a trustworthy online gaming platform. Players should always look for visible indicators of security, such as the padlock icon in the browser’s address bar, signifying a secure connection.
Two-Factor Authentication and Account Verification
Adding an extra layer of security, two-factor authentication (2FA) is increasingly adopted by online casinos. This process requires players to provide two different forms of identification – something they know (like a password) and something they have (like a code sent to their mobile device). 2FA significantly reduces the risk of unauthorized access, even if a password is compromised. Account verification, although sometimes seen as an inconvenience, is another crucial security measure. This process involves submitting documentation to confirm the player’s identity and address, preventing fraudulent activity and ensuring that funds are transferred to legitimate accounts.
The verification process typically requires copies of identification documents like passports or driver’s licenses, as well as proof of address such as utility bills or bank statements. While it may seem intrusive, this step is vital for maintaining the integrity of the platform and protecting all users from potential scams. A casino that prioritizes account verification demonstrates a genuine commitment to responsible gaming and financial security. It’s important for players to understand and cooperate with the verification process to ensure a smooth and secure gaming experience.

Exploring Bonus Structures and Promotional Offers
Online casinos frequently utilize b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. A welcome bonus is typically offered to new players upon their first deposit, providing an initial boost to their bankroll. Deposit matches involve the casino matching a percentage of the player's deposit, effectively giving them extra funds to play with. Free spins allow players to spin the reels of a slot game without wagering any of their own money. Loyalty programs reward players based on their activity, offering points or rewards that can be redeemed for bonuses or other benefits. Understanding the terms and conditions attached to these offers is paramount.
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, are a crucial aspect to consider. These requirements specify the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means the player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before they can cash out. Other important terms include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and expiration dates. Some bonuses may only be valid on specific games, while others may have a maximum bet size. Failing to adhere to these terms can result in the forfeiture of bonus funds and any associated winnings. It's also important to be aware of any deposit methods that may be excluded from bonus eligibility. A careful review of the terms and conditions can prevent misunderstandings and ensure a fair gaming experience.

Understanding Withdrawal Limits and Processing Times
Withdrawal limits dictate the maximum amount a player can withdraw within a specific timeframe (daily, weekly, or monthly). These limits can vary significantly between casinos and may depend on the player's VIP status. Processing times refer to the duration it takes for the casino to approve and process a withdrawal request. Typically, e-wallet withdrawals are processed faster than bank transfers or credit card withdrawals. The casino's terms and conditions should clearly state the expected processing times for each payment method. Players should be aware that additional verification checks may be required for large withdrawals, potentially extending the processing time.
Understanding these factors will help players manage their expectations and ensure a smooth withdrawal process. Choosing a casino with reasonable withdrawal limits and efficient processing times is crucial for a positive gaming experience. If a casino consistently delays withdrawals or imposes unreasonably low limits, it may be a sign of untrustworthiness. Transparency and clear communication regarding withdrawal policies demonstrate a commitment to fairness and player satisfaction.

Customer Support and Responsible Gaming Initiatives
Responsive and helpful customer support is paramount for a positive online casino experience. Players may encounter questions or issues that require assistance, and a readily available support team can provide valuable guidance. Typical support channels include live chat, email, and phone support. Live chat is often the preferred method, offering instant assistance and real-time problem-solving. Email support provides a more detailed response, while phone support can be useful for more complex issues. The quality of customer support can be assessed by its responsiveness, knowledgeability, and willingness to resolve issues effectively. A casino that values its players will invest in a well-trained and dedicated support team.
Responsible gaming initiatives are equally crucial. Reputable casinos prioritize the well-being of their players and offer tools and resources to promote responsible gambling habits. These initiatives may include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and access to problem gambling support organizations. De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it within a specific timeframe. Loss limits set a maximum amount a player can lose over a period. Self-exclusion allows players to temporarily or permanently ban themselves from accessing the casino. Providing links to organizations like GamCare and Gamblers Anonymous demonstrates a commitment to responsible gaming and providing support to those who may be struggling with gambling addiction. A casino that actively promotes responsible gaming demonstrates a sense of ethical responsibility and genuine care for its players.
Future Trends and Innovations in Online Casino Security
The online casino industry is constantly evolving, with new technologies and security threats emerging regularly. One significant trend is the increasing adoption of bl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ies for enhanced security and transparency. Blockchain's decentralized nature makes it inherently resistant to fraud and manipulation. Biometric authentication, such as fingerprint scanning and facial recognition, is also gaining traction as a more secure alternative to traditional passwords. These methods add an extra layer of protection, making it more difficult for unauthorized individuals to gain access to accounts.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are being employed to detect and prevent fraudulent activity in real-time.
AI algorithms can analyze patterns of behavior to identify suspicious transactions and flag potential risks. These proactive measures help to safeguard players' funds and maintain the integrity of the gaming platform.
